Srinagar, Mar 11: Opposition National Conference on Sunday said PDP’s “declaration” that Kashmir was “not a political issue but a social issue” was a shocking and shameful U-turn by the party which has for years sought support and votes primarily to help in the resolution of the political issue.

Addressing a press conference at party headquarters  here on Sunday, NC general secretary Ali Muhammad Sagar, who was flanked by provincial president Nasir Aslam Wani and state spokesperson Junaid Mattu, lashed out at the Chief Minister and PDP president Mehbooba Mufti and her party for their “total sell-out”.

Referring to the Finance Minister Dr. Haseeb A. Darbu’s “outrageous statement” as the “the last nail in the PDP’s coffin”, Sagar said the declaration that Kashmir was apparently not a ‘political issue’ but a ‘social issue’ was a serious development that called into question the very basis of PDP’s politics over the years, and the promises it had been making to the people of the State.

“If PDP thinks that Kashmir is not a ‘political issue’ but is according to them a ‘social issue’, then it brings question mark to dangle over the very basis of the politics of PDP and that of its founder Late Mufti Sahab,” Sagar said.

“Till today we were led to believe that PDP’s basis was the resolution of the political issue and its rhetorical advocacy for dialogue was a cornerstone of its narrative,” he said.

“Today, the same party suddenly declares that Kashmir is not a political issue and the problems we are facing are not any different from those being faced by people outside Kashmir. We condemn this statement in the strongest of terms as it reeks of fallacy, delusion and indicates an enormous ideological U-turn for the party,” Sagar said.

He asked Mehbooba Mufti to clarify if this was the final and formal abandonment of the party’s ‘Self Rule’ document, which till now was being portrayed as the party’s supreme vision document.

“First the PDP violated the mandate of 2014 by entering into an opportunistic alliance with a party it had sought votes against, and today the same party finally lets the cat out of the bag by declaring everything it stood for till now was apparently akin to ‘barking up the wrong tree’ as has been said by Dr. Haseeb Drabu,” Sagar said.

“We want to ask the Chief Minister and the PDP president if Kashmir is not a political issue, then why have thousands of people lost their lives and why does the state continue to be mired by instability, violence and lack of peace and normalcy?

“Why did you promise the people that your party would work towards helping in resolving the political issue when you don’t even consider the issue to be political to start with?” NC asked.

Speaking on the occasion, Wani hit out at the PDP for “fooling” the people of the State for almost two decades by seeking their “personal political empowerment by exploiting the political sentiment that they are now openly ridiculing. “
